> The MC-level call to getSchedClassDesc can return a “variant” scheduling class. Trying to perform queries on it will probably assert. You can check SCDesc->isVariant() and bailout in that case.
Thanks for the information.
Fixed in r191864.
>
> Resolving the variant SchedClass requires an MI to pass to SubTargetInfo::resolveSchedClass.
>
> As you’re aware, the latencies aren’t necessarily useful without determining the consumer anyway. Tools that want more complete and useful information from the machine model will need to build an MI-level CFG. Hopefully, that will be lightweight once MI is extracted from CodeGen.

>> Log:
>> [llvm-c][Disassembler] Add an option to print latency information in
>> disassembled output alongside the instructions.
>> E.g., on a vector shuffle operation with a memory operand, disassembled
>> outputs are:
>> * Without the option:
>> vpshufd $-0x79, (%rsp), %xmm0
>>
>> * With the option:
>> vpshufd $-0x79, (%rsp), %xmm0 ## Latency: 5
>>
>> The printed latency is extracted from the schedule model available in the
>> disassembler context. Thus, this option has no effect if there is not a
>> scheduling model for the target.
>> This boils down to one may need to specify the CPU string, so that this
>> option could have an effect.
>>
>> Note: Latency < 2 are not printed.
>>

>> +/// \brief Gets latency information for \p Inst, based on \p DC information.
>> +/// \return The maximum expected latency over all the definitions or -1
>> +/// if no information are available.
>> +static int getLatency(LLVMDisasmContext *DC, const MCInst &Inst) {
>> + // Try to compute scheduling information.
>> + const MCSubtargetInfo *STI = DC->getSubtargetInfo();
>> + const MCSchedModel *SCModel = STI->getSchedModel();
>> + const int NoInformationAvailable = -1;
>> +
>> + // Check if we have a scheduling model for instructions.
>> + if (!SCModel || !SCModel->hasInstrSchedModel())
>> + return NoInformationAvailable;
>> +
>> + // Get the scheduling class of the requested instruction.
>> + const MCInstrDesc& Desc = DC->getInstrInfo()->get(Inst.getOpcode());
>> + unsigned SCClass = Desc.getSchedClass();
>> + const MCSchedClassDesc *SCDesc = SCModel->getSchedClassDesc(SCClass);
>> + if (!SCDesc || !SCDesc->isValid())
>> + return NoInformationAvailable;
>> +
>> + // Compute output latency.
>> + int Latency = 0;
>> + for (unsigned DefIdx = 0, DefEnd = SCDesc->NumWriteLatencyEntries;
>> + DefIdx != DefEnd; ++DefIdx) {
>> + // Lookup the definition's write latency in SubtargetInfo.
>> + const MCWriteLatencyEntry *WLEntry = STI->getWriteLatencyEntry(SCDesc,
>> + DefIdx);
>> + Latency = std::max(Latency, WLEntry->Cycles);
>> + }
>> +
>> + return Latency;
>> +}
>> +
>> +
>> +/// \brief Emits latency information in DC->CommentStream for \p Inst, based
>> +/// on the information available in \p DC.
>> +static void emitLatency(LLVMDisasmContext *DC, const MCInst &Inst) {
>> + int Latency = getLatency(DC, Inst);
>> +
>> + // Report only interesting latency.
>> + if (Latency < 2)
>> + return;
>> +
>> + DC->CommentStream << "Latency: " << Latency << '\n';
>> +}
